A little penis pain every now and then is inevitable, but in most cases, it’s something that passes quickly. A guy gets hit in the crotch, for example, and the pain is intense but usually of relatively short duration. But occasionally, more lasting pain occurs, creating a cause for concern. One such cause is male genital dyaesthesia, also commonly called penis dyaesthesia.

In certain circumstances, a red penis is nothing more than an erect penis. That is, the redness is caused simply by the flow of blood into the penis that creates an erect state. Sometimes, however, a red penis may be a sign of a potential penis health issue. One such issue, with which men are generally not familiar, is known as penile dyaesthesia.
